Title

Reserved manifest bin names can make global package operations delete outside the global bin directory

</details>

Description

Summary

Manifest bin object keys such as "", ".", and ".." passed pnpm's bin-name guard. When a malicious package was installed globally, later global remove, update, or add-replacement flows could re-derive those names from the installed manifest and pass path.join(globalBinDir, binName) to removeBin. For "." this targets the global bin directory; for ".." this targets its parent.

Details

The vulnerable dataflow was:

- bins/resolver/src/index.ts converted manifest bin object keys to binName and only required URL-safe text or $. Empty, dot, dot-dot, and scoped forms such as @scope/.. were not rejected after scope stripping. - global/packages/src/scanGlobalPackages.ts scanned installed global package manifests and returned manifest-derived bin.name values. - global/commands/src/globalRemove.ts, global/commands/src/globalUpdate.ts, and global add replacement logic joined those names to globalBinDir. - bins/remover/src/removeBins.ts recursively removed the resulting path.

Install-time checks did not close the gap: bin target paths were package-root checked, conflict checks looked at the same escaped path but did not reject reserved segments, and bin-link warning paths could leave the package installed for later global operations.

Severity

Corrected vulnerable severity: High

Corrected vulnerable vector string: CVSS:3.1/AV:N/AC:L/PR:N/UI:R/S:U/C:N/I:H/A:H

Corrected vulnerable score: 8.1

Final post-patch score: 0.0, not vulnerable after patch.

The original scan score was 8.3 with C:H/I:H/A:L. Revalidation removes direct confidentiality impact and raises availability to high because the sink can recursively delete the global bin directory or its parent.

Weaknesses

CWE-22: Improper Limitation of a Pathname to a Restricted Directory

CWE-73: External Control of File Name or Path

Patch

- bins/resolver/src/index.ts now rejects empty, dot, and dot-dot bin names after scope stripping. - bins/resolver/test/index.ts covers empty, dot, dot-dot, and scoped reserved bin keys. - global/commands/test/globalRemove.test.ts proves global remove filters reserved manifest bin names before deletion and only removes a safe good shim. - pacquet/crates/cmd-shim/src/binresolver.rs mirrors the same reserved-name rejection; empty names were already rejected. - pacquet/crates/cmd-shim/src/binresolver/tests.rs extends parity coverage. - .changeset/strange-bin-segments.md records patch releases for @pnpm/bins.resolver, pnpm, and pacquet.

Pacquet parity is appropriate at the shared bin resolver/linker boundary because pacquet dependency-management commands can resolve and link package bins, even though the TypeScript-only global remove/update/add replacement flow is the concrete destructive-delete sink.

pnpm is a package manager. Prior to 10.34.2 and 11.5.3, Manifest bin object keys such as "", ".", and ".." passed pnpm's bin-name guard. When a malicious package was installed globally, later global remove, update, or add-replacement flows could re-derive those names from the installed manifest and pass path.join(globalBinDir, binName) to removeBin. For "." this targets the global bin directory; for ".." this targets its parent. This vulnerability is fixed in 10.34.2 and 11.5.3.
